跳转到主要内容
ComfyUI 是一个模块化的 GenAI 推理引擎,可以部署为 API 服务器、通过接口调用、用自定义节点扩展,也能用命令行管理。根据你的需求选择下面的路径。

部署 ComfyUI 作为 API 服务

在自有环境中运行 ComfyUI 并将其暴露为 API 端点。了解 WebSocket 消息协议、可用路由和执行模式。

服务概览

从本地服务器搭建开始,了解消息类型、路由处理和执行模型反转。
另见:消息与路由 · 执行模型反转 · Partner Node API 集成

Cloud API

在 Comfy Cloud 上以编程方式运行工作流,无需管理硬件。使用 REST API、查看 OpenAPI 规范,并通过 API Key 集成 Partner Node。

Cloud API 概览

了解如何认证、提交任务、查询状态以及从 Comfy Cloud 下载结果。
另见:API 参考 · OpenAPI 规范 · 获取 API Key

Agent Tools / MCP

通过模型上下文协议(MCP)将 AI 代理连接到 ComfyUI。使用托管的 Cloud MCP 或在本地运行 Partner MCP 服务器,对接 30+ 个服务商。

MCP 概览

比较 Cloud MCP 和 Partner MCP,找到适合你 AI 代理集成的方式。
另见:Comfy Cloud MCP · Comfy Partner MCP

Comfy CLI

通过命令行管理 ComfyUI 的安装、自定义节点和工作流。轻松完成安装、更新、配置和自动化。

CLI 快速上手

了解如何从终端安装、更新和管理 ComfyUI。
另见:CLI 参考 · 故障排除

开发自定义节点

自定义节点让你可以通过 Python 后端、JavaScript UI 组件和外部集成来扩展 ComfyUI。这是为 ComfyUI 生态做贡献最强大的方式之一。

快速入门

自定义节点新手?了解节点结构、发布方法和最佳实践。

关键页面:教程 · v3 迁移指南

后端(Python)

构建自定义节点的服务端。涵盖数据类型、图像与遮罩处理、惰性求值、张量操作等。

关键页面:数据类型 · 图像与遮罩 · 惰性求值 · 节点扩展示例

前端(JavaScript)

为节点添加自定义 UI 组件、侧边栏标签页、快捷键和对话框,完全掌控 ComfyUI 的前端。

关键页面:钩子(Hooks) · 侧边栏标签页 · 命令与快捷键 · 示例代码
另见:国际化(i18n)

注册表(Registry)

通过 Comfy 注册表发布和管理你的自定义节点。注册表为社区提供版本控制、安全扫描和节点发现能力。

发布概览

注册为发布者、发布你的第一个节点、认领已有节点,并配置 CI/CD 实现自动化发布。
另见:发布教程 · 标准 · CI/CD · 规范